A New Scanning Electron Microscope

• Lakeview has just received a $77,000 grant to purchase a new Scanning Electron Microscope (SEM for short).

• SEM’s are used professionally to see objects on the scales that are used in nanotechnology

• An SEM scans a beam of electrons across a sample to produce an image.

• Objects can be magnified from 10x - 300,000x.

• We will be able to see objects as small as three nanometers across
